The Town of Miami Lakes Cultural Affairs Committee, under the leadership of  chairperson Neill Robinson, celebrated Scottish-American Heritage (Tartan) month in late March. The celebration which was held in the evening near the Main Street fountain featured the St. Andrews Bagpipe band of Miami.
